From the capital of Boise, through the rugged Sawtooth Mountains, to the banks of the Coeur d'Alene, the largest mountain bike stage race in the world is taking over Idaho.

Boise, ID
XC, 40 miles, 3,000 ft elevation, technical singletrack, Boise River Greenbelt views
Murphy, ID
Marathon, 50 miles, 3,500 ft, gravel/dirt, cultural sites, remote
Ketchum, ID
XC, 35 miles, 2,800 ft, single/double-track, Boulder Mountains
Pocatello, ID
Enduro, 40 miles, 3,200 ft, technical singletrack, urban/rural mix
Idaho Falls, ID
XC, 40 miles, 2,800 ft, paved/gravel, urban river views
Idaho Falls, ID
Marathon, 50 miles, 3,600 ft, gravel/singletrack, rural vistas
Rest Day
Cultural events with Shoshone-Bannock Tribe
Salmon, ID
Marathon, 60 miles, 4,000 ft, gravel/singletrack, Shoup area
Salmon, ID
XC, 40 miles, 3,000 ft, singletrack, remote, river views
Stanley, ID
Enduro, 45 miles, 4,000 ft, technical singletrack, Sawtooth vistas
Stanley, ID
Marathon, 55 miles, 3,700 ft, gravel/singletrack, Redfish Lake views
Lowman, ID
Time Trial, 30 miles, 2,500 ft, fast gravel, hot springs access
Lowman, ID
Enduro, 45 miles, 3,800 ft, technical singletrack, remote
McCall, ID
Enduro, 45 miles, 3,500 ft, technical singletrack, Ponderosa State Park
McCall, ID
Time Trial, 30 miles, 2,700 ft, fast singletrack, ski resort terrain
Rest Day
Hot springs recovery, community events
Lapwai (Nez Perce), ID
Marathon, 55 miles, 3,700 ft, gravel/dirt, cultural sites, Clearwater River
Coeur d’Alene Tribe
XC, 45 miles, 2,900 ft, paved rail-trail, Lake Coeur d’Alene views
Lookout, ID
Time Trial, 30 miles, 2,600 ft, fast gravel, Hiawatha Trail
Kellogg, ID
Enduro, 40 miles, 3,400 ft, technical singletrack, mining history
Sandpoint, ID
Enduro, 40 miles, 3,500 ft, technical singletrack, Lake Pend Oreille
Sandpoint, ID
Marathon, 50 miles, 3,600 ft, gravel/singletrack, scenic lake views
Coeur d'Alene, ID
XC, 40 miles, 3,000 ft, paved/singletrack, urban finale, lake views
Tour D'Alene Live is the explosive, lakefront grand finale concert that crowns 23 days of the longest mountain bike race in the world.
Held on the shores of Lake Coeur d’Alene immediately following the final sprint stage, this is no ordinary afterparty — it’s a full-scale, high-production spectacle designed to feel like the Super Bowl halftime show meets a frontier music festival.
